Re: let me see your 5 1/2 x 5 inch static drop

You are asking for a combo that most likely nobody runs. 4 1/2"-6" drop, 5"-7", 2 1/2"-4". My own truck is 4 1/2" - 7" with a leaf spring flip. But nobody does a 5 1/2" -5" drop which is odd for one of these. Too much in the front and not enough in the rear. Here's my 4 1/2" -7". My short step has about as big a tire as you can get on a stepside without bed mods. 275 55 17 on 17x9" wheel with 5" backspace using a 72 width axle. The front is 235 55 17 on 17x8" wheel with 4.5" bs.
